MS104 : Grewia rothii DC.

Class : Magnoliopsida
Order : Malvales
Family : Tiliaceae - Linden family
Genus : Grewia
Species : Grewia rothii DC.
Plant Location in Melghat : Bori, Raipur  
Plant Category : Shrubs  
Plant's Current Status : Vulnerable (IUCN 2.3)  
Plant Family : Tiliaceae  

 
Plant Common Name : -
 
Synonym : Grewia arborea (Forssk.) Lam.
Grewia excelsa Vahl.


Description : Small trees or shrubs. Leaves 3 - 16.5 x 1 - 5.5 cm, ovate-oblong or ovate-lanceolate, obtuse or subacute at base, acute or acuminate at apex, serrulate, densely tomentose beneath, 3 - 4-nerved; petioles ca 5 mm long. Flowers in axillary, clustered cymes; peduncles 1.5 - 3.5 cm long; buds 35 - 5 mm across, subglobose, tomentose; pedicels 8 - 10 mm long. Sepals ca 6 mm long, elliptic-oblong or elliptic-lanceolate, tomentose. Petals ca 3 mm long, ovate-lanceolate; glands ca 1 mm long, elliptic. Stamens many; filaments 3 - 4 mm long, glabrous. Ovary ca 1.5 mm across, globose, tomentose; stigma 4-lobed. Drupes ca 5 mm across, globose, tomentose, edible. Fl. April- Oct.; Fr. June - Dec.
 
Curated Medicinal Use / Activity : remedy for Diarrhea and dysentery
